#4e7324 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4e7324 is composed of 30.6% red, 45.1%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 68.7%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 88.1 degrees, a saturation of 52.3% and a lightness of 29.6%. #4e7324 color hex could be obtained by blending #9ce648 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#4e7324 color description : Dark moderate green.
#4e7324 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4e7324 has RGB values of R:78, G:115,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0.32, M:0, Y:0.69,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 5141284.

Shades and Tints of #4e7324
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070a03 is the darkest color, while #fcfefa is the lightest one.

Tones of #4e7324
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4c5047 is the less saturated color, while #509601 is the most saturated one.
